Validated outputs

SVG and DXF that are proven before you download.

A stencil that looks fine on screen can still be un-cuttable. MonuOS checks the geometry, not just the picture — and the two files have to match before either one leaves the platform.

The MonuOS binary stencil view with a validation checklist: all paths closed, no self-intersections, minimum feature 0.040 in, minimum gap 0.030 in, islands supported, no duplicate geometry, no raster images, no live text, physical units and scale known, polarity reviewed. A banner notes the SVG and DXF disagreed, so the export is blocked until they match.
The validation checklist runs on every stencil. Here the SVG and DXF differed by more than the tolerance, so downloads stayed locked — the plotter view shows exactly where.

Closed paths only, true inch scale

The emitters output path geometry — a raster can never reach the file — with all loops closed and no self-intersections, at physical inches with a known scale.

Feature & gap floors

Minimum feature and minimum gap are checked against your entered values (for example 0.040 in feature, 0.030 in gap), so nothing is too thin to weed or too tight to blast.

SVG ≡ DXF, or no download

The SVG and DXF are compared to each other. If they disagree by more than the tolerance, both downloads lock and the plotter view points to the difference — a mismatched file never ships.

No live text

Lettering is traced to real outline geometry, never font-dependent text — so there's no font substitution on the plotter and nothing shifts between machines.

Islands & polarity handled

Islands are supported for the adhesive-mask workflow, and polarity is reviewed and approved — blast the design or Invert for a raised finish, with normal and inverted stencils both available.

What files does MonuOS export?

Validated SVG and DXF at true inch scale with closed paths only, plus a scale-accurate PDF proof. Both files are verified equivalent to each other before either can be downloaded.

Will the stencil import at the right size?

Yes. The export carries physical units and a known scale (dpi at your entered width), so it imports at true size in industry cutter software — no rescaling at the plotter.

Do I have to set the size first?

No. The vector is scalable, so you can build the stencil now and set the physical width when you're ready to cut.

Does it keep circles round and curves smooth?

The contour tracer emits simple, closed rings and the repair pass smooths edge chatter, so round elements and curves stay clean rather than faceted. Pick a smoother isolation candidate or add the optional AI line-cleanup for uniform strokes.

Can I get normal and inverted stencils?

Yes. Choose Blast Design or Invert for a raised finish — normal and inverted stencils are both produced so either sandblast workflow is covered.

Does it change my artwork?

Isolation is fidelity-first: candidates are scored against your photograph and you approve the result. Any AI line-cleanup is optional, checked against your artwork, and reversible.
